Board briefing: Closure of the Varnwick satellite office. Headcount of nine; six accept relocation to Dorsley, three take severance. Lease terminates at quarter-end with no penalty. Annualised savings estimated at a mid-six-figure sum. Client coverage transfers to the Dorsley hub without service interruption. No external announcement planned before completion. Context for the decision follows below.

confidential, yahip-hagug: Gorixax Logistics plans to lower the Ulaael list price by 26.6 percent in October. The pricing group signed off on a budget of $199.9 million for Project Holix. The renewal with Kasdorox Systems closes at $137.5 million a year, 8.2 percent above the last contract. Project Lamion slips by a full year because of the audit delay.

### Step 4: Migrate GridSmith to the new solver config

Stop the GridSmith crossword generator before touching anything. Remove the legacy solver block from the old INI file — the v3 engine ignores it and logs warnings forever. Word-list paths move into the main config. Clue-difficulty weights are now mandatory. Write the new config file with exactly the following values.

config for haweg-bagag:
[kasath]
host = kasath.qirvancorp.internal
user = kasath_svc
database = kasath_prod

Visitors are not permitted in the Quiet Room on the ninth floor of Harfield House. New starters may use it after induction week. No calls, no meetings, no food. Escort any visitor who wanders up back to reception immediately. The door locks automatically; entry requires the current pass code, given below.

door code, kahap-kawip: bdg-XUDDCY-22034334

Subject: Key rotation — Queuewright migration

Hi, and welcome aboard. As part of retiring our homegrown job queue (Queuewright) in favor of the new Taskloom service, we rotated the internal dispatch key this morning. Old keys stop working Friday. Any worker you touch during the migration should be updated to call the Taskloom enqueue endpoint with the new credential. For your setup, the current key follows.

app token of tagef-tafog = qvz3-7n0

## Release Runbook — ScanBridge plugin channel

Plugin authors: builds targeting the ScanBridge barcode scanner integration must pass the conformance suite before submission. Tag your release, run `scanbridge verify`, and bundle the manifest. Unsigned plugins are rejected at upload. Rotation notices go out two weeks ahead via the Hollowpine portal. Sign your artifact against the current channel key, shown here:

rollout seal: bky4_x7Gc